The Battle of the Bats: A Tale of Two Teams

In the thrilling world of baseball, a recent game between the Los Angeles Dodgers and the Chicago White Sox showcased a fascinating display of power and strategy. The game, a testament to the sport's unpredictability, was a treat for fans and analysts alike.

Ohtani's Opening Act

The game kicked off with a bang, courtesy of Shohei Ohtani's leadoff home run. This set the tone for what was to come, as Ohtani's prowess with the bat is well-documented. Personally, I believe Ohtani's ability to consistently deliver such powerful hits is a testament to his exceptional talent and focus. What many don't realize is that leading off with a home run can significantly boost team morale, setting a challenging tone for the opposing team.

Muncy's Mighty Swing

The Dodgers continued their offensive onslaught with Max Muncy's two-run home run in the first inning. This, in my opinion, was a strategic move to capitalize on the momentum gained from Ohtani's opening act. Muncy's timing and precision are often overlooked, but they are crucial in such high-pressure situations.

Tucker's Tactical Approach

Fast forward to the third inning, and we witness Kyle Tucker's RBI single, a result of a broken bat. This, to me, is a perfect example of how baseball is as much about adaptability as it is about power. Tucker's ability to adjust and still deliver a run is a skill that deserves recognition.

Bases-Loaded Drama

The sixth inning brought even more excitement as Tucker drew a bases-loaded walk. This strategic move, in my analysis, showcases the Dodgers' patience and discipline at the plate. It's not always about swinging for the fences; sometimes, a calculated approach can yield greater results.
